Expressing Enthusiasm And Interest In The Job Opportunity

When applying for a job, its crucial to convey your enthusiasm and genuine interest in the position and the company. Employers seek candidates who are not only qualified but also passionate about the work they do. One effective way to demonstrate your enthusiasm is through a well-crafted introduction letter. In this article, we will explore the significance of expressing enthusiasm and interest in a job opportunity and provide practical tips on how to accomplish this in your introduction letter.

Research and Understand the Company

Before expressing your enthusiasm, it is essential to research and understand the company you are applying to. Familiarize yourself with their mission, values, culture, and recent achievements. This knowledge will allow you to tailor your letter and show genuine interest in the organization. Additionally, researching the company will help you identify specific aspects of the job opportunity that excite you and align with your career goals.

Begin with a Compelling Opening Statement

The opening paragraph of your introduction letter is your chance to immediately capture the readers attention and express your enthusiasm. Start with a strong and captivating statement that highlights why you are excited about the job opportunity. You can mention what attracted you to the position, the companys reputation, or any unique aspects of the role that resonate with your professional aspirations. A compelling opening sets a positive tone and encourages the reader to continue reading.

Showcase Knowledge of the Company

In the body of your introduction letter, demonstrate your knowledge of the company and its industry. Discuss specific projects, products, or initiatives the company is involved in and explain why they resonate with you. By showcasing your understanding of the companys work, you prove that your enthusiasm is rooted in genuine interest and that you have taken the time to learn about their operations. This level of detail helps differentiate you from other candidates and shows your commitment to the job opportunity.

Highlight Alignment of Values and Goals

Expressing enthusiasm goes beyond stating your interest in the job; it also involves highlighting how your values and goals align with those of the company. Identify shared values, such as a commitment to innovation, social responsibility, or customer satisfaction, and emphasize how your professional aspirations and skills align with these values. Demonstrating this alignment shows that you not only want the job but that you are a good fit for the companys culture and can contribute meaningfully to its success.

Discuss Relevant Experiences and Skills

To further express your enthusiasm and interest, discuss specific experiences, skills, or achievements that are relevant to the job opportunity. Highlight projects or responsibilities from your past that demonstrate your passion for the field and your ability to excel in the role you are applying for. By showcasing your accomplishments, you provide evidence of your enthusiasm and show how your previous experiences have prepared you for the challenges of the new role.

Use Positive and Engaging Language

The tone and language you use in your introduction letter play a significant role in expressing your enthusiasm. Be positive, upbeat, and engaging in your writing. Use confident and active language to convey your excitement and interest. Avoid generic or overly formal phrases and instead focus on conveying your genuine enthusiasm for the job. Employers are more likely to be drawn to candidates who exhibit a positive and engaging demeanor.

Customize and Personalize the Letter

To truly express your enthusiasm, customize and personalize your introduction letter for each job application. Tailor your letter to the specific requirements and preferences of the company and the role. Use the job description as a guide to highlight relevant skills and experiences that make you a strong fit. By personalizing your letter, you demonstrate a sincere interest in the job opportunity and showcase your dedication to securing the position.
